COMBINED CAROTID ARTERY STENTING (CAS) AND CORONARY ARTERY BYPASS GRAFTING (CABG)

Tamer Sayed Fouad Sayed;

Abstract


Perioperative stroke and ischemic encephalopathy are two well-recognized complications of co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G)

Surgical treatment of simultaneous coronary and carotid disease is still controversial
